LAHORE, (APP - U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News - 12th Mar, 2026) A major project to digitize the historic Quaid-e-Azam Library has been launched to bring it in line with modern requirements.
According to details, under this project, the target has been set to make most of the library’s academic and research collections available online in the next two to three years, while the plan to establish a “Jinnah Corner” in the library has also been completed, which is expected to be inaugurated after Eid.
Director General Punjab Libraries Kashif Manzoor said in a statement that Quaid-e-Azam Library is not only considered one of the important reference and research libraries in Lahore but also in the country, where there are currently about two and a half million books, while access to millions of online research resources is also being provided.
He said that under the ongoing digitization project, the library's collection is being transferred to digital form in stages so that researchers and students can benefit from this intellectual capital from any part of the world.
He said that the history of the current building goes back to the mid-nineteenth century and this building was initially used as a gymnasium.
Later, the gymnasium was shifted to Zafar Ali Road and this building remained under the use of the Civil Services academy, while military offices were also established here during martial law. Later, in 1984, this building was converted into a regular library and opened to the public.
According to the Director General of Punjab Libraries, the Quaid-e-Azam Library is primarily a reference and research library where encyclopedias and other research materials are provided especially for researchers. However, students preparing for CSS and PMS and other competitive exams also come here in large numbers and benefit from the academic environment.
On the other hand, students using the library say that the book collection available here provides them with authentic information. According to CSS candidate Ghulam Murtaza, there is a lot of material available online, but its accuracy is questioned, while authentic references are found in books.
According to various CSS preparation students, many official documents, records and rare books are still not available online, so the library is still an important and reliable source of information for research and educational purposes.
